The journal is found by Dipper in " Tourist Trapped," when he unknowingly locates Ford's artificial metal tree in the forest. Designing a security mechanism hidden above his bunker, Ford kept Journal 3 hidden for years until his disappearance through the Interdimensional Portal.ĭipper uncovers the compartment containing Journal 3. Fearful he was being watched by malevolent forces, Ford hid his three journals in separate and elaborate locations around Gravity Falls, hoping to keep the knowledge needed to activate the Interdimensional Portal away from evil forces. Among the series of cultural touchpoints that make you both laugh and cry, Flowers recreates classic magazine ads idealizing women’s needs for hair relaxers and product. Her hair is the team curio, an object to touched, a subject to be discussed and debated at the will of her teammates, leading Lena to develop an anxiety disorder of pulling her own hair out. The story “My Lil Sister Lena” traces the stress resulting from being the only black player on a white softball team. It’s a scenario that repeats fifteen years later as an adult when, tired of the maintenance, Flowers shaves her head only to be hurled new put-downs. In “Virgin Hair” taunts of “tender-headed” sting as much as the perm itself. The titular story “Hot Comb” is about a young girl’s first perm-a doomed ploy to look cool and to stop seeming “too white” in the all-black neighborhood her family has just moved to.
